One advise I would give is make sure your hopper is at least 5+ more bps than your trigger. Before I got my Fasta I was using a hopper that ran at 15 bps and my trigger ran at 13 bps and I found that it was not fast enough. Now if you get a forced feed hopper that differance can be closer.
